From d3c04bd57f9063eff4d6bd5337f553a5916dd87e Mon Sep 17 00:00:00 2001 From: Marc Ransome Date: Mon, 29 Nov 2021 07:33:45 +0000 Subject: [PATCH] Disable password expiry for service users --- ansible/roles/tuxedo/tasks/main.yml | 7 +++++++ 1 file changed, 7 insertions(+) diff --git a/ansible/roles/tuxedo/tasks/main.yml b/ansible/roles/tuxedo/tasks/main.yml index 3abfd22..f31cd3b 100644 --- a/ansible/roles/tuxedo/tasks/main.yml +++ b/ansible/roles/tuxedo/tasks/main.yml @@ -113,6 +113,10 @@ system: no loop: "{{ tuxedo_service_users }}" +- name: Disable password expiry for service users + command: "chage -m 0 -M 99999 -I -1 -E -1 {{ item.name }}" + loop: "{{ tuxedo_service_users }}" + - name: Create Informix group group: name: "{{ informix_service_group }}" @@ -126,6 +130,9 @@ shell: /bin/bash system: yes +- name: Disable password expiry for Informix user + command: "chage -m 0 -M 99999 -I -1 -E -1 {{ informix_service_user }}" + - name: Create .bash_profile for service users template: src: bash_profile.j2